Tornado Intelligence
Tornadoes are violently rotating columns of air extending from thunderstorms to the ground. They can produce winds exceeding 300 mph and cause devastating damage along their paths. The central United States, known as Tornado Alley, experiences the highest frequency of tornadoes, with peak season from April through June.
